Many fans of Punjabi music argue that the old version of "Moosedrilla" by Sidhu Moose Wala is superior to the final version released on the album in 2021. The debate typically focuses on the following points: Original Production
The initial or “old” version of Moosedrilla was produced by popular music director Harj Nagra. This original beat and musical arrangement was later reworked and polished to become the final track released on the Moosetape album. The final version, as most fans know it, was produced by The Kidd.
